Rescued 9 fishermen on 2 sunken ships in Kien Hai Special Zone due to thunderstorms

An Giang - Border Guard forces, people and vehicles found 9 fishermen on the 2 fishing boats and brought them to the Border Guard Safety Control Station.

At 9:30 a.m. on July 28, Nam Du Border Guard Station (An Giang) received information from the public about a sunken vehicle in an area about 2 nautical miles southeast of Hon Lon (in the waters of Cu Tron Hamlet, Kien Hai Special Zone, An Giang Province).

Preliminary information, due to heavy rain accompanied by thunderstorms, the CM-05006-TS squid fishing vehicle sank, including 5 crew members. The ship is captained by Mr. Nguyen Van Khoi (born in 1974, residing in Ca Mau province).

Then, at 9:50 a.m. the same day, the unit continued to receive information from the people about an area about 2.5 nautical miles southeast of Hon Lon (in the sea area of Cu Tron hamlet, Kien Hai Special Zone, An Giang province) where a vehicle had sunk due to heavy rain and thunderstorms.

CM-05430-TS fishing vehicle consists of 4 crew members. Mr. Tran Van Doan (born in 1980, residing in Ca Mau province) is the captain (vehicle owner).

After receiving the information, the Party Committee and the unit Command promptly sent 10 comrades to divide into 2 groups led by Lieutenant Colonel Nguyen Thanh Nhan.

Mobilized 2 tourist boats Ngoc Lam and Sau Co along with other fishing boats to support the search. By 10:35 a.m. the same day, the unit had found 9 crew members on the 2 affected ships and brought them to Bai Chet Border Control Station to ensure safety and health care.

At 15:10 on the same day, the Working Group, along with fishermen and mobilized vehicles, salvaged and towed the two vehicles to the Bai Chet port area to carry out repairs and repair. The process of performing the task of ensuring the safety of people and vehicles.
